I still prefer thief gameplay to mesmer. I don’t think it would take much to boost thief. It is still a strong profession, but offers very little room for mistakes. It is probably the highest risk meta pvp build out there. Sure if you are focused you can stay up and run from anyone, but if you want to get involved with the fight, you have to be on your toes and focused. I find any day I’m a little sleepy, I can’t pvp well on thief. It is the only profession that has my skill so directly connected to my state of mind. It reminds of counter strike.
So the thief is a fun profession, but it is hard to play well, and play consistently well.
I’m also looking forward to flipping all over the place as a daredevil. So I say it’s still worth playing. Still hoping for a few changes though.

The staff wasn’t perfect, but I found it to be the funnest pve weapon for thief. I am not ecstatic about the auto attack, which I think would work better if the final part of the chain came first, so when you haven’t hit anyone with it it can be used readily to reflect projectiles. I also don’t like the staff 4 blind, it sucks as is, and no reduced cast time will make it good, unless they lower the ini cost to something like 1. It does too little for too much cost.
